In the episode, “A Conversation with British Psychiatrist Dr. Sami Timimi on His New Book: Searching For Normal: A New Approach to Understanding Mental Health, Distress, and Neurodiversity”(S6, E14), Dr. Timimi delivers a deeply humane and fiercely argued wake-up call: most of what we’ve been told about mental health simply isn’t true—and believing it is harming our children, our culture, and ourselves.
From the point of view of a child and adolescent psychiatrist and psychotherapist, Dr. Timimi shares how early on he was not comfortable with the status quo of his field. In his work, he highlights how what the public is being told about the nature of mental health is misleading and may be harming our collective sense of well-being. Dr. Timimi explains how labels like ADHD and Autism have exploded over the years, especially among children and teens. He puts forth that psychiatric labels are good examples of “scientism,” or science as faith rather than fact. He shares what the evidence-based medicine approach actually tells us and explains why the number of children getting diagnosed with such labels has skyrocketed over the years in relation to broadening definitions. Sami speaks about the Mental Health Industrial Complex and how the label and diagnosis phenomenon of Western Psychiatry has taken away other meaning making frameworks regarding suffering in Western society, but also as a global approach to mental health.
Dr. Timimi shares about “psychiatric brands” and concept creep, and how in both America and in the UK, early intervention in mental health initiatives in schools also play a factor in the increase of diagnoses. Dr. Timimi calls for a radical shift starting with letting go of psych labels, a decrease in psych meds, and promotion of a public narrative that normalizes emotions.

BIO
Dr. Sami Timimi is a child and adolescent psychiatrist, psychotherapist, and Fellow of the Royal College of Psychiatrists. He has published more than 150 academic papers and authored or edited over a dozen books, including Naughty Boys, Liberatory Psychiatry, and The Myth of Autism.
